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Alder | scarlet flame-bean |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Fagales (Beeches & Oaks) |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) |
| Family | Betulaceae | Fabaceae |
| Genus | Alnus | Brownea |
| Species | Alnus glutinosa | Brownea coccinea |
Evolutionary Relationship
Alder and scarlet flame-bean share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
